Output-2 (User Defined). This pin provides the user a general
purpose output. See bit-3 modem control register (MCR bit-
3).
Power Supply Input.
Crystal or External Clock Input - Functions as a crystal input
or as an external clock input. A crystal can be connected
between this pin and XTAL2 to form an internal oscillator
circuit. An external 1 MW resistor is required between the
XTAL1 and XTAL2 pins (see figure 3). Alternatively, an
external clock can be connected to this pin to provide
custom data rates (Programming Baud Rate Generator
section).
Output of the Crystal Oscillator or Buffered Clock - (See also
XTAL1). Crystal oscillator output or buffered clock output.
Carrier Detect (active low) - A logic 0 on this pin indicates
that a carrier has been detected by the modem.
Clear to Send (active low) - A logic 0 on the -CTS pin
indicates the modem or data set is ready to accept transmit
data from the ST16C450. Status can be tested by reading
MSR bit-4. This pin has no effect on the UART’s transmit or
receive operation.
Data Set Ready (active low) - A logic 0 on this pin indicates
the modem or data set is powered-on and is ready for data
exchange with the UART. This pin has no effect on the
UART’s transmit or receive operation.
Data Terminal Ready (active low) - A logic 0 on this pin
indicates that the ST16C450 is powered-on and ready. This
pin can be controlled via the modem control register.
Writing a logic 1 to MCR bit-0 will set the -DTR output to
logic 0, enabling the modem. This pin will be a logic 1 after
writing a logic 0 to MCR bit-0, or after a reset. This pin has
no effect on the UART’s transmit or receive operation.
